A way to compile source code under windows is to install Cygwin... But
even with cygwin I did'n manage to compile libraries under windows (if
anyone has som clues... I think it is related to some file headers)
Anyway, you can build your GTK interface without a GUI builder, it is
very very easy.

>  I want to  implement  a  GUI for  my program.  Provided for rapid
> development,  I need to a GUI builder. MLGlade and Zoggy are two popular GUI
> builders. Both of them are intended for  Linux  OS but I develop my program
> in Windows OS. I tried to compile source code of those tools but I could not
> do that. Because  There is  need to  utilities such as  ./configure and
> autoconfig that are not in Windows OS.
>  Does any friend know a GUI builder for Windows OS.?
